【Tesseral-Pro集群监控实操】:实时追踪系统性能的顶级技巧
发布时间: 2024-12-25 00:05:53 阅读量: 8 订阅数: 11
Tesseral-Pro手册(中文版).pdf
![【Tesseral-Pro集群监控实操】:实时追踪系统性能的顶级技巧](https://d1v0bax3d3bxs8.cloudfront.net/server-monitoring/disk-io-iops.png)
# 摘要
本文全面介绍了Tesseral-Pro集群监控系统,从基础理论到高级应用,详细阐述了集群监控的重要性、关键指标、监控工具以及优化策略。文章探讨了监控系统的安装、配置、性能优化以及数据分析方法,并分享了成功案例和常见问题的解决方案。文中还分析了集群监控技术的未来发展趋势,特别是在人工智能和机器学习中的潜在应用。通过这些内容,本文旨在为读者提供集群监控实施的最佳实践指南,以确保系统性能的最优化和故障的及时响应。
# 关键字
集群监控;性能优化;故障预警;数据可视化;实时追踪;人工智能应用
参考资源链接:[Tesseral-Pro全波场正演模拟系统用户手册](https://wenku.csdn.net/doc/9a762yece8?spm=1055.2635.3001.10343)
# 1. Tesseral-Pro集群监控概述
随着信息技术的飞速发展,企业对于集群系统的依赖程度越来越高,集群监控逐渐成为确保系统稳定运行的关键技术之一。Tesseral-Pro作为一款先进的集群监控解决方案,不仅提供了基础的监控功能,更在性能优化、故障预警等方面展现了强大的实力。本章将概览Tesseral-Pro集群监控的核心功能和应用场景,为后续章节的深入探讨奠定基础。
## 1.1 集群监控的技术背景
集群监控的核心目的是为了确保集群系统的稳定性、高可用性和性能优化。它通过持续收集集群中各节点的运行数据,分析这些数据以发现问题、优化性能,并在系统出现异常时及时发出警报。技术背景包括但不限于数据采集、传输、存储、分析和可视化等方面。
## 1.2 Tesseral-Pro监控解决方案的优势
Tesseral-Pro集群监控解决方案之所以能在众多监控工具中脱颖而出,关键在于其采用的创新技术以及对客户需求的深入理解。它不仅能够实现对集群的全面监控,还能够适应不同规模和复杂度的集群环境,并提供定制化的监控策略,使得监控更加高效和智能。
# 2. 集群监控的基础理论
## 2.1 集群监控的目的和重要性
### 2.1.1 监控的定义及其在集群中的角色
监控是在IT环境中保持系统稳定运行不可或缺的一环。具体到集群环境中,监控可以被定义为一种机制,用于实时追踪、记录、报告集群中的各种活动和性能指标。监控在集群中的角色主要体现在以下几个方面:
1. **性能评估**:监控可以收集集群的性能数据,评估系统运行状况,确保集群性能处于合理范围。
2. **异常检测**:通过实时监控数据,能够及时发现集群中的异常行为,如服务宕机、资源滥用或安全威胁。
3. **容量规划**:监控数据的长期趋势分析有助于合理规划资源分配,优化集群扩展性。
4. **故障诊断**:当集群出现性能瓶颈或故障时,监控数据是故障诊断的重要参考依据。
5. **合规性和审计**:在某些行业,如金融和医疗,合规性要求监控系统记录操作日志,以满足审计需求。
### 2.1.2 监控对于性能优化的贡献
集群监控不仅帮助管理者及时了解集群的健康状况,而且对于性能优化起到了至关重要的作用:
1. **性能瓶颈识别**:监控能够帮助定位集群中的性能瓶颈,如CPU、内存或网络I/O等。
2. **资源优化配置**:通过对性能数据的分析,可以合理调整资源分配,提高资源利用率。
3. **自动化伸缩**:结合监控数据和预设策略,集群可以自动进行横向或纵向伸缩,以适应不断变化的负载需求。
4. **历史数据分析**:长期的监控数据存储能够用于历史性能分析,为未来性能优化提供依据。
5. **系统调优**:监控数据能够指导系统调优工作,包括参数优化、代码优化等。
## 2.2 集群监控的关键指标
### 2.2.1 性能指标的选择和分析
在集群监控中,选择正确的性能指标至关重要。这些指标需要能够全面反映集群的健康状况和性能水平。以下是几个关键的性能指标:
1. **CPU Utilization**: 计算机处理器的使用率,过高可能表明存在瓶颈,影响集群性能。
2. **Memory Usage**: 内存的使用情况,内存不足可能导致频繁的页交换和应用性能下降。
3. **Disk I/O**: 磁盘输入/输出的性能,对于存储密集型应用尤其重要。
4. **Network Bandwidth**: 网络带宽,衡量数据传输速率。
5. **Latency**: 系统响应时间,包括应用响应时间和网络延迟。
在分析这些指标时,应结合实际业务负载模式,评估其对业务的影响,以便做出适当的优化调整。
### 2.2.2 指标采集的频率与精度考量
性能指标的采集频率直接影响到监控系统的准确性和实时性。采集频率过高可能会导致过多的数据积累,增加了存储和处理的压力;过低则可能导致监控盲区,错过关键的性能变化。因此,在采集频率与精度之间需要有一个平衡:
1. **实时性要求高的指标**:如CPU Utilization和Memory Usage,需要较高的采集频率。
2. **重要性较低的指标**:如某些系统日志,可以适当降低采集频率。
3. **精度**:在允许的情况下,应选择具有较高精度的监控工具来保证数据准确性。
### 2.2.3 故障检测与预警机制
监控系统不仅要能够检测和记录当前的集群状态,还要能够预测可能出现的故障,并及时发出预警。设计有效的故障检测与预警机制需要考虑以下因素:
1. **阈值设置**:通过设置合理的阈值,当性能指标超出正常范围时触发警告。
2. **自动报警**:集成短信、邮件、即时通讯等多种报警方式,确保关键信息能够迅速传达给相关负责人。
3. **趋势分析**:通过分析指标趋势,可以提前识别潜在问题,并采取预防措施。
## 2.3 集群监控工具介绍
### 2.3.1 开源监控工具与Tesseral-Pro比较
开源监控工具如Nagios、Zabbix以及Prometheus等,因其灵活性和成本效益,在IT行业中广受欢迎。然而,与Tesseral-Pro这样的专业集群监控解决方案相比,它们在某些方面可能存在局限性:
1. **功能性**:Tesseral-Pro提供了更为全面的集群监控解决方案,如自动发现、应用性能管理(APM)等高级功能。
2. **易用性**:专业工具通常提供更加直观的用户界面和更好的用户体验。
3. **集成性**:Tesseral-Pro往往提供更多的第三方系统集成,易于与其他系统协同工作。
4. **技术支持**:专业的集群监控解决方案通常提供更完善的客户支持。
### 2.3.2 集成监控解决方案的选择标准
在选择合适的集群监控解决方案时,需要考虑以下标准:
1. **业务需求**:根据业务特点和监控需求,选择能够满足这些需求的工具。
2. **易用性**:选择界面友好、操作简便的工具,可以降低使用门槛,提高工作效率。
3. **可扩展性**:随着业务的发展,监控系统应该能够支持无缝扩展。
4. **成本效益**:评估监控系统的总体拥有成本(TCO),包括软件许可费、维护成本和员工培训费用。
5. **社区支持与服务**:评估社区支持的活跃度和专业服务团队的响应速度和质量。
接下来的章节将继续深入探讨Tesseral-Pro集群监控实践部署、高级应用以及案例分析等方面的内容。
# 3. Tesseral-Pro集群监控实践部署
## 3.1 Tesseral-Pro集群监控的安装与配置
### 3.1.1 安装前的准备工作
在开始部署Tesseral-Pro集群监控之前,必须进行一系列的准备工作以确保监控系统的稳定性和效率。准备工作包括以下步骤:
- **环境评估**:检查集群环境是否满足Tesseral-Pro的系统要求,包括操作系统版本、硬件配置、网络连通性等。
- **用户权限配置**:为Tesseral-Pro创建专用的系统用户,确保该用户具有足够的权
0
0